Climate finance: Council adopted conclusions ahead of COP27

Wed, 10/05/2022 - 06:45
Ahead of UNFCCC COP27, the Council adopted conclusions underlining its strong commitment to deliver on climate finance. The Council recalled that the EU and its member states are the largest contributor to international public climate finance, and since 2013 have more than doubled their contribution to climate finance to support developing countries. In its conclusions, the Council calls on other donors to step up efforts in this regard, and it expects that the collective USD 100 billion per year climate finance mobilisation goal will be met in 2023.

Taxation: Anguilla, The Bahamas and Turks and Caicos Islands added to EU list of non-cooperative jurisdictions for tax purposes

Wed, 10/05/2022 - 06:45
The Council adopted conclusions on the revised EU list of non-cooperative jurisdictions for tax purposes. A total of 12 countries have either not engaged in a constructive dialogue with the EU on tax governance or have failed to deliver on their commitments to implement the necessary reforms.

Council agrees on emergency measures to reduce energy prices

Sat, 10/01/2022 - 06:30
EU energy ministers today reached a political agreement on a proposal for a Council Regulation to address high energy prices. The regulation introduces common measures to reduce electricity demand and to collect and redistribute the energy sector's surplus revenues to final customers.
